I would like to take a moment to pause in my usual routine of talking about Evelyn. I work as a special educator. It is a hard profession but I love it. Today is World Autism Awareness Day and April is Autism Awareness Month. Recently there was a report that now 1 in 88 children are diagnosed with autism or on the spectrum. I am not asking for anything but if anyone is reading this, I just wanted to share this info. I work with this children every day and it is a rewarding job.
